区块链数据交易的安全性如何?

区块链作为一种去中心化的分布式账本技术,具备较高的数据交易安全性。其安全性有以下几个方面保障:

1. 去中心化架构:区块链网络中的数据交易不依赖于单一的中心机构,而是通过众多节点的共识机制实现验证和确认。这使得黑客攻击和数据篡改变得更加困难。

2. 数据加密:区块链中的交易数据使用加密算法进行保护,使得未经授权的访问和篡改变得几乎不可能。只有通过私钥才能解密和访问数据。

3. 分布式存储:区块链将数据分散存储在网络中的各个节点上,而不是集中存储在单一的服务器中。这样即使某些节点出现问题或被攻击,其他节点上的数据仍然可用。

4. 共识机制:区块链网络中的节点通过共识算法进行交易验证和确认,确保数据交易的可信度和一致性。不同的共识机制有不同的安全性特点,如比特币采用的工作量证明机制。

区块链数据交易存在哪些安全风险?

虽然区块链具备较高的安全性,但仍然存在一些安全风险:

1. 51%攻击:如果某一组织或个人掌握超过区块链网络51%的节点算力,他们有可能篡改交易数据以及破坏整个网络的安全性。

2. 智能合约漏洞:智能合约是区块链上自动执行的代码,存在编程错误可能导致合约被攻击。例如,DAO(去中心化自治组织)的漏洞导致了大量以太币被盗。

3. 交易合法性:尽管数据交易在区块链上不可篡改,但如果参与交易的各方存在欺诈行为,交易可能仍然存在合法性问题。

4. 隐私保护:虽然区块链使用了加密技术来保护数据安全,但仍然存在部分隐私泄漏的风险。例如,在公开链上的交易可以追溯到参与者的身份。

如何提升区块链数据交易的安全性?

为了提升区块链数据交易的安全性,可以采取以下措施:

1. 采用多种共识机制:比特币等公有链的工作量证明机制在安全性上具有一定的缺陷,可以考虑引入其他共识机制,如权益证明(PoS)或股份授权(DPoS),以增强网络的安全性。

2. 加强智能合约安全审计:对于智能合约的编写和执行过程,进行严格的安全审计,发现和修复潜在的漏洞,防止黑客攻击和合约被利用。

3. 加强身份验证和权限管理:通过引入身份验证技术和权限控制机制,确保只有合法的参与者能够访问和交易数据,防止恶意行为的发生。

4. 隐私保护技术的应用:通过使用零知识证明、同态加密等隐私保护技术,对交易数据进行加密和匿名化处理,保护用户的隐私信息。

区块链数据交易是否可以防止数据篡改?

区块链使用了去中心化的共识机制,使得数据交易的篡改变得极为困难。一旦数据被写入区块链,就几乎不可能改变或删除。每个区块包含了前一个区块的哈希值,形成了一个由链条组成的数据结构,任何篡改都会破坏整个链条的连续性。

但需要注意的是,如果某一组织或个人掌握了超过51%的算力,他们有可能通过共识机制的操纵来篡改区块链的数据。因此,在公有链上,区块链数据交易的安全性仍然存在一定的风险,尤其是对于规模小的区块链网络。

区块链是否支持匿名交易?

区块链本身并不完全支持匿名交易,因为交易数据被写入公开的区块中,可以被任何人查询和追溯。公有链上的交易记录是透明的,可以追溯到参与者的身份。

然而,可以使用隐私保护技术来增强区块链的匿名性。例如,零知识证明技术可以实现在不泄露具体交易细节的情况下,证明某一方拥有某一项资产。同时,混币技术和匿名钱包等工具也可以用于隐藏交易的发送者和接收者身份。

区块链数据交易存在安全漏洞吗?

区块链数据交易并非绝对安全,仍然存在一些安全漏洞:

1. P2P网络攻击:区块链网络中的节点之间通过P2P协议进行通信,可能受到DDoS攻击、重放攻击等。攻击者可以通过控制多个节点来操纵网络。

2. 物理攻击:如果攻击者能够控制区块链网络中的大量节点,他们有可能对节点进行物理攻击,如硬件篡改、物理层攻击等。

3. 用户端安全漏洞:用户在使用区块链钱包等工具时,如果对个人账户、私钥不当处理,容易受到恶意软件、钓鱼攻击等。

问题7:区块链的未来发展如何影响数据交易的安全性?

区块链的未来发展将对数据交易的安全性产生重要影响:

1. 扩展性:目前公有链的扩展性仍然存在挑战,交易速度较慢,费用较高。随着技术的发展,如闪电网络、侧链等解决方案的应用,区块链的扩展性将得到提升,交易的确认时间和成本将降低。

2. 隐私保护技术发展:未来隐私保护技术将得到进一步发展和应用,使得在区块链上进行匿名交易变得更加安全可靠。

3. 跨链互操作性:随着不同区块链项目的发展,跨链互操作性将成为一个重要的发展方向。不同链之间的数据交易将得到更好的连接和保护。

总体来说,随着区块链技术的不断发展和完善,区块链数据交易的安全性将得到进一步提升,但仍需要不断加强安全意识和采取有效的安全措施来应对潜在的风险。